gcrypt: Remove limited crypto plugin

This has not seen any significant changes for years.  So it lacks support
for modern algorithms and would require quite some work for an overhaul.
Given that we support several other crypto backends, let's just remove
this to reduce the maintenance burden.

The test scenarios and other references are also removed.
